Andrea Padova

Andrea Padova

Italian Classical Pianist and Composer

Andrea Padova is an Italian classical pianist and composer known for his interpretations of Baroque and contemporary music. He has gained recognition for his performances and recordings of Johann Sebastian Bach's works, among which the "Goldberg Variations" stand out as a significant achievement in his discography. Padova studied at the Conservatorio di Musica Santa Cecilia in Rome and furthered his education in Paris and Salzburg, where he honed his skills under the guidance of distinguished musicians such as Nikita Magaloff, Jacques Rouvier, and György Sandor. His career has been marked by both solo performances and collaborations with orchestras, as well as participation in international competitions where he has received accolades. In addition to performing, Andrea Padova is also dedicated to composition, with a repertoire that includes chamber music, vocal works, and pieces for solo instruments.
